JavaExample 1 - robot control panel
Example 2 - micromouse (maze solving algorithms)
Example 3 - Sierpinski triangle
Example 4 - affine transformations (translation, rotation, scaling)
Click on the frame to add a green obstacle. You can move the obstacles in any area of the frame by moving your mouse and holding down the mouse button. Double-clicking on an obstacle removes it. Additionally two sliders allow you to rotate and scale the selected object.
Example 5 - vacuum cleaning robot
Click on the blue frame to determine the robot's starting position. Use the following keys to control the simulation:
- R - run simulation
- P - pause simulation
- S - stop simulation
Example 6 - Puzzle (robot platform)
Using the left mouse button select the section of the image, then move the mouse cursor on the selected target field and click the right mouse button (section of the image will be moved to that location).
Example 7 - 3D Rectangle
Example 8 - RGB